The Amel Super Maramu is the original go anywhere do anything Bluewater mile muncher. This very clever design allows for both full crewed and short handed bluewater cruising.
This 2003 Amel Super Maramu is a well proven example and has been well loved by her current owners.
Rascal is a AMEL Super Maramu 2000, built in 2003. The vendor has owned and lived on board for five years, and has extensively maintained, upgraded and replaced her systems so she really is ready to go wherever and whenever you wish to go. All parts used are either Amel sourced new parts, or high quality well recognised parts. For example, Calpeda and Marco pumps.
By request there is a detailed list of work done over the last five years, a list of key system spares and a complete parts inventory spreadsheet, with the location of where these parts are stored.
The boat is currently ashore in Grenada.

Key facts
Model: Amel Super Maramu
Year: 2003
Registered : London, UK
Hull number: 404
Engine: Yanmar 4JHTE, 5,900 hrs (but has had a major overhaul in March 2025, more details below
Gen Set: Onan, 3,900 hrs
Water Maker: Dessalator 160LPH, 769 hrs
Sails: Q sails Genoa, main & Mizzen (2021/2022) Ballooners Doyle (2022) Precision
Asymmetric 2022
Standing rigging: ACMO 2019
Running rigging; All replaced in 2022/23 except main and mizzen halyards, new mizzen staysail halyard and new genoa sheets, Jan 2025
Anitfoul: Dec 2024 with Seahawk Colorcote
Electrical package: 600AmPH 24v Lithium (2021), 1.235kw of Maxeon LR6 Solar panels on an custom stainless arch all controlled by Victon MPPT's, Cerbus GX mk2 and two Victron Quattro 3KW Inverters, mounted in parallel.
Powers: 220 &110 AC, 24 &12 DC
Key details:-
Engine: Yanmar 110Hp unit. 4JHTE, 5900 hours
March 2025:
New ZF Transmission & Bowman Oil cooler
New Engine brake (Amel)
NEW Vetus coupling & Bushings
New Input shaft for C drive
New Yanmar Transmission Dampner
4 new Yanmar Injectors
Valve clearances checked and adjusted
Intercooler, oil cooler, water cooler and Turbo all removed, cleaned and replaced etc
All fluids and filters replaced.
Electronics:
All Lithium battery bank 600 Amph 24v of Battleborn batteries, 2020.
Two Victron 3kw Quattro Inverters in Parallel one installed in 2020 the second in June 2022
Victron 24/12 battery charger / conditioner between house bank and Engine start. The engine start was replaced with a new unit in Oct 2023.
Victron Cerbus Mk 2 Control unit and panel mounted in galley
Victron MPPTS for solar arch
Three Maxeon LR6 435 Solar panels (March 2025)
Genset:-
Onan 7.5kw with 3,350 hours and works faultlessly.
o New motherboard Oct 2024
o New starter Oct 2024
o New Raw water pump Dec 2025
o Full service Nov 2024 (all filters, fluids and impeller etc)
Nav Equipment:- Raymarine, NMEA 2k backbone.
5 Raymarine i70s head units (2021)
2 Raymarine i70 autohelm units (2021)
Axiom 9 MFD in Nav station (2021)
Raymarine Quantum 2 Radar (2021)
Raymarine Axiom pro 12 MFD at helm station
Echopilot 2D FLS forward looking sonar (2021)
Digital Yacht AIT5000 Class B+ Transponder
Raymarine LM2 Autopilot RAM (two new units, one as spare)
Raymarine VHF 63 (2022) including remote wireless and speaker handset at helm
Nov 2024 the Depth and speed transducer was replaced with a new DST810 unit, plus there is an additional spare DST 810 in the spares.
(All software updated in Oct 24)
In addition :
Two Iridium Go units, both with SIM cards.
Predictwind Datahub. (Nov 2024)
Brand new Starlink Mini mounted permanently on the solar arch, and wired though to the nav station with a mesh wifi repeater.
Rigging & Sails:
All standing rigging replaced with ACMO in 2019
Q Sails Hyrdanet Genoa (2021). The Genoa was removed in March 2025 to be checked by Turbulence, here in Grenada. They replaced the Sunbrella and tidied up the stitching and clew, replaced the telltales.
Doyle balloners (matching original Amel colours and cut, but slightly heavier fabric). Both new in 202 and both used. The mizzen Balloner is in an ATN sock for ease of hoist and drop.
Q sails new Main and Mizzen, Hydranet Nov 2022
New Precision Code Zero, plain white with Amel logo printed. In an ATN sock (July 2022.)
Amel Caribe in Martinique serviced the Genoa furler and forestay in March 2022
Main furler gear box and motor were replaced in Feb 2022 with Amel units.
Galley
GN Espace Induction hob and stove
Sage convection oven and airfyer
New washing machine in original position (2022)
Fridgoboat MS130RD stainless steel two drawer unit and Capri 50 compressor in main galley, fitted in 2021
All new Corian Galley tops, custom built to fit on top of existing galley units. Dishwasher space re purposed to be food storage, matching corian
Fidge and freezers in main salon area have been rebuilt with new highly efficient insulation and all new Fridgoboat compressors (Capri's). The evaporator plates were updated in Oct 2023
Seagul water filter in Galley sink
Watermaker:-
Desalator 160LPH unit (570 hours)
New Calpeda LP pump Jan 2025
New Desalator HP pump and Motor Nov 2024
Safety equipment:
Two EPIRBS, UK Registered, serviced in Mar 2021 when they were transferred from US to UK registry.
Numerous fire extinguishers (serviced early 2021)
Jan 2025, new 4 man Seago 24hrs+ liferaft installed within the port side rail, custom welder into the rail.
Purpose built Jordan Series drogue all dyneema lines with 147 cones and chain.
Three hand held VHF's
Two life jackets, proper ones
Two Harnesses
Jack stays
Airconditioning
Three units, fully operational and gassed in Nov 2024
Aft Cabin was replaced with a Clima 9 unit in 2022.
Webasto heater system fitted as standard in Redline, fully operational.
